.dev-hero{padding:var(--space-24)0 var(--space-32);isolation:isolate;position:relative}@media (max-width:720px){.dev-hero{padding:var(--space-16)0 var(--space-20)}}.dev-hero-grid{gap:var(--space-16);grid-template-columns:minmax(0,1.1fr) minmax(0,1fr);align-items:center;display:grid}@media (max-width:960px){.dev-hero-grid{gap:var(--space-12);grid-template-columns:1fr}}.dev-hero-text{gap:var(--space-6);flex-direction:column;display:flex}.dev-hero-eyebrow{align-items:center;gap:var(--space-3);width:fit-content;display:inline-flex}.dev-hero-eyebrow:before{content:"";background:var(--accent);width:24px;height:1px}.dev-hero-lead{max-width:56ch}.dev-hero-cta{align-items:center;gap:var(--space-3);margin-top:var(--space-4);flex-wrap:wrap;display:flex}.dev-hero-meta{margin-top:var(--space-6);gap:var(--space-2);color:var(--ink-500);flex-direction:column;display:flex}.dev-hero-meta-row{align-items:center;gap:var(--space-3);font-size:13px;display:flex}.dev-hero-meta-row svg{color:var(--ink-400);flex-shrink:0}.dev-hero-code{height:460px;position:relative}@media (max-width:960px){.dev-hero-code{order:-1;height:400px}}
.dev-code-preview{border:1px solid var(--ink-200);border-radius:var(--radius-lg);width:100%;height:100%;transition:border-color var(--motion-base)var(--ease-out-soft),box-shadow var(--motion-base)var(--ease-out-soft);background:#0a0a0b;flex-direction:column;font-family:ui-monospace,JetBrains Mono,SF Mono,Cascadia Code,Roboto Mono,Menlo,monospace;display:flex;position:relative;overflow:hidden}.dev-code-preview:hover{border-color:var(--accent);box-shadow:0 0 0 1px var(--accent),var(--shadow-3)}.dev-code-preview-chrome{align-items:center;gap:var(--space-3);padding:0 var(--space-4);background:#131316;border-bottom:1px solid #27272a;height:40px;display:flex}.dev-code-preview-dots{flex-shrink:0;gap:6px;display:flex}.dev-code-preview-dots span{background:#2a2a2e;border-radius:50%;width:10px;height:10px}.dev-code-preview-tabs{margin-left:var(--space-3);align-items:center;gap:0;display:flex}.dev-code-tab{font-family:inherit;font-size:var(--text-mono-sm);color:#71717a;cursor:pointer;transition:color var(--motion-fast)var(--ease-out-soft);background:0 0;border:none;padding:6px 12px;position:relative}.dev-code-tab:hover{color:#d4d4d8}.dev-code-tab[data-active=true]{color:var(--accent)}.dev-code-tab[data-active=true]:after{content:"";background:var(--accent);height:1px;position:absolute;bottom:-1px;left:12px;right:12px}.dev-code-preview-copy{border-radius:var(--radius-sm);font-family:inherit;font-size:var(--text-mono-xs);color:#a1a1aa;cursor:pointer;transition:color var(--motion-fast)var(--ease-out-soft),border-color var(--motion-fast)var(--ease-out-soft),background var(--motion-fast)var(--ease-out-soft);background:0 0;border:1px solid #27272a;align-items:center;gap:6px;margin-left:auto;padding:4px 10px;display:inline-flex}.dev-code-preview-copy:hover{color:#fafafa;border-color:#3f3f46}.dev-code-preview-copy[data-copied=true]{color:#4ade80;background:#4ade800f;border-color:#4ade804d}.dev-code-preview-body{padding:var(--space-5)var(--space-6);flex:1;position:relative;overflow:hidden}.dev-code-preview-pane{font-family:inherit;font-size:var(--text-mono-sm);color:#e4e4e7;white-space:pre;clip-path:inset(0);animation:dev-code-wipe-in var(--motion-slower)var(--ease-out-expo);margin:0;line-height:1.65}@keyframes dev-code-wipe-in{0%{clip-path:inset(0 100% 0 0)}to{clip-path:inset(0)}}.dev-code-preview-foot{padding:var(--space-3)var(--space-5);font-size:var(--text-mono-xs);color:#52525b;background:#0a0a0b;border-top:1px solid #27272a;justify-content:space-between;align-items:center;display:flex}.tok-comment{color:#52525b;font-style:italic}.tok-keyword{color:#c9a84c}.tok-string{color:#a7f3d0}.tok-number{color:#fde68a}.tok-fn{color:#fbbf24}.tok-prop{color:#f4f4f5}.tok-punct{color:#a1a1aa}.tok-meta{color:#818cf8}.tok-url{color:#67e8f9;-webkit-text-decoration:underline #67e8f94d;text-decoration:underline #67e8f94d}
.dev-section{padding:var(--space-32)0}@media (max-width:720px){.dev-section{padding:var(--space-20)0}}.dev-section-header{gap:var(--space-4);max-width:64ch;margin-bottom:var(--space-16);flex-direction:column;display:flex}.dev-section-header__eyebrow{align-items:center;gap:var(--space-3);width:fit-content;display:inline-flex}.dev-section-header__eyebrow:before{content:"";background:var(--accent);width:24px;height:1px}.dev-scenario-grid{gap:var(--space-4);grid-template-columns:repeat(4,1fr);display:grid}@media (max-width:1100px){.dev-scenario-grid{grid-template-columns:repeat(2,1fr)}}@media (max-width:560px){.dev-scenario-grid{grid-template-columns:1fr}}.dev-scenario-card{gap:var(--space-5);padding:var(--space-8);background:var(--surface-raised);border:1px solid var(--ink-200);border-radius:var(--radius-lg);transition:transform var(--motion-base)var(--ease-out-soft),border-color var(--motion-base)var(--ease-out-soft),box-shadow var(--motion-base)var(--ease-out-soft);isolation:isolate;flex-direction:column;display:flex;position:relative;overflow:hidden}.dev-scenario-card:before{content:"";border-radius:var(--radius-lg);background:linear-gradient(180deg,color-mix(in srgb,var(--accent)5%,transparent),transparent 40%);opacity:0;transition:opacity var(--motion-base)var(--ease-out-soft);pointer-events:none;z-index:-1;position:absolute;inset:0}.dev-scenario-card:hover{border-color:var(--ink-300);box-shadow:var(--shadow-hover);transform:translateY(-4px)}.dev-scenario-card:hover:before{opacity:1}.dev-scenario-card-icon{width:48px;height:48px;color:var(--ink-900);transition:transform var(--motion-base)var(--ease-out-soft);justify-content:center;align-items:center;display:flex}.dev-scenario-card:hover .dev-scenario-card-icon{transform:rotate(6deg)}.dev-scenario-card-title{font-family:var(--font-playfair),Georgia,serif;letter-spacing:-.025em;color:var(--ink-900);font-size:24px;font-weight:600}.dev-scenario-card-providers{font-family:var(--font-dm-sans),system-ui,sans-serif;color:var(--ink-500);font-size:13px;line-height:1.55}.dev-scenario-card-meta{align-items:center;gap:var(--space-3);padding-top:var(--space-4);border-top:1px solid var(--ink-200);margin-top:auto;display:flex}.dev-scenario-card-time{letter-spacing:.04em;color:var(--ink-400);text-transform:uppercase;font-family:ui-monospace,SF Mono,monospace;font-size:11px}
.dev-flow{background:var(--ink-50);border:1px solid var(--ink-200);border-radius:var(--radius-xl);padding:var(--space-16)var(--space-12);position:relative;overflow:hidden}.dev-flow:before{content:"";pointer-events:none;background:radial-gradient(circle at 0 0,#c9a84c0a,#0000 35%),radial-gradient(circle at 100% 100%,#c9a84c08,#0000 35%);position:absolute;inset:0}.dev-flow-row{grid-template-columns:repeat(4,1fr);align-items:center;gap:0;display:grid;position:relative}@media (max-width:880px){.dev-flow-row{gap:var(--space-8);grid-template-columns:1fr}}.dev-flow-node{z-index:2;align-items:center;gap:var(--space-4);padding:var(--space-6)var(--space-4);text-align:center;flex-direction:column;display:flex;position:relative}.dev-flow-node-glyph{background:var(--surface);border:1px solid var(--ink-200);border-radius:var(--radius);width:64px;height:64px;color:var(--ink-900);transition:border-color var(--motion-base)var(--ease-out-soft),box-shadow var(--motion-base)var(--ease-out-soft),transform var(--motion-base)var(--ease-out-soft);justify-content:center;align-items:center;display:flex}.dev-flow-node:hover .dev-flow-node-glyph{border-color:var(--accent);transform:translateY(-2px);box-shadow:0 0 0 4px #c9a84c14}.dev-flow-node-label{font-family:var(--font-dm-sans),system-ui,sans-serif;color:var(--ink-900);letter-spacing:-.005em;font-size:14px;font-weight:600}.dev-flow-node-meta{color:var(--ink-400);letter-spacing:.04em;text-transform:uppercase;font-family:ui-monospace,SF Mono,monospace;font-size:11px}.dev-flow-node-desc{font-family:var(--font-dm-sans),system-ui,sans-serif;color:var(--ink-500);max-width:22ch;margin-top:var(--space-1);font-size:13px;line-height:1.55}.dev-flow-track{top:calc(var(--space-6) + 32px);background:var(--ink-200);z-index:1;height:1px;position:absolute;left:12.5%;right:12.5%;overflow:hidden}.dev-flow-track:after{content:"";background:linear-gradient(90deg,transparent,var(--accent),transparent);width:28px;height:2px;animation:dev-flow-token 4.6s var(--ease-in-out)infinite;border-radius:999px;position:absolute;top:-.5px;left:0}@keyframes dev-flow-token{0%{opacity:0;transform:translate(-30px)}10%{opacity:1}90%{opacity:1}to{opacity:0;transform:translate(calc(100% + 30px))}}@media (max-width:880px){.dev-flow-track{display:none}}.dev-flow-track-vertical{display:none}@media (max-width:880px){.dev-flow-track-vertical{background:var(--ink-200);width:1px;height:32px;margin:0 auto;display:block;position:relative;overflow:hidden}.dev-flow-track-vertical:after{content:"";background:linear-gradient(180deg,transparent,var(--accent),transparent);width:2px;height:18px;animation:dev-flow-token-v 2.4s var(--ease-in-out)infinite;border-radius:999px;position:absolute;top:0;left:-.5px}@keyframes dev-flow-token-v{0%{opacity:0;transform:translateY(-20px)}20%{opacity:1}80%{opacity:1}to{opacity:0;transform:translateY(40px)}}}
.dev-trust{background:var(--ink-900);color:var(--ink-50);border-radius:var(--radius-xl);padding:var(--space-16)var(--space-12);position:relative;overflow:hidden}.dev-trust:before{content:"";pointer-events:none;background:radial-gradient(circle at 20% 0,#d4b8601a,#0000 35%),radial-gradient(circle at 80% 100%,#d4b8600d,#0000 35%);position:absolute;inset:0}.dev-trust-grid{gap:var(--space-8);grid-template-columns:repeat(4,1fr);display:grid;position:relative}@media (max-width:880px){.dev-trust-grid{gap:var(--space-12)var(--space-6);grid-template-columns:repeat(2,1fr)}}@media (max-width:480px){.dev-trust-grid{grid-template-columns:1fr}}.dev-trust-cell{gap:var(--space-3);flex-direction:column;display:flex}.dev-trust-value{font-family:var(--font-playfair),Georgia,serif;letter-spacing:-.04em;font-variant-numeric:tabular-nums;color:var(--ink-50);align-items:baseline;font-size:clamp(40px,5vw,64px);font-weight:600;line-height:1;display:inline-flex}.dev-trust-suffix{color:var(--accent);letter-spacing:-.02em;margin-left:.05em;font-size:.55em;font-weight:500}.dev-trust-prefix{color:var(--accent);margin-right:.05em;font-size:.55em;font-weight:500}.dev-trust-label{font-family:var(--font-dm-sans),system-ui,sans-serif;letter-spacing:.04em;text-transform:uppercase;color:#fafafa73;font-size:13px}.dev-trust-helper{font-family:var(--font-dm-sans),system-ui,sans-serif;color:#fafafa8c;max-width:22ch;margin-top:var(--space-2);font-size:13px;line-height:1.55}
